Our Verdict
The MG Hector Plus continues to be a strong contender in the midsize SUV segment, offering a blend of spaciousness, decent performance and a rich feature set at a competitive price. Its 1.5‑litre turbo petrol and 2.0‑litre diesel engines deliver smooth power, while the 6‑speed manual or 7‑speed DCT keep acceleration respectable for city and highway use. The cabin feels premium with a 10.1‑inch infotainment screen, digital instrument cluster, and ambient lighting, and the 7‑seat layout remains flexible for families. Safety credentials have improved, now featuring six airbags, ESC, and a 5‑star Global NCAP rating, boosting confidence. Fuel efficiency sits around 15‑16 km/l for the petrol and 18‑19 km/l for diesel, acceptable for its size. MG’s after‑sales network has expanded, and the 3‑year/1‑lac km warranty adds peace of mind, though long‑term reliability still trails established rivals. Ownership costs are moderate, with reasonable service intervals and affordable parts. Overall, the Hector Plus offers a compelling package for buyers seeking a roomy, tech‑laden SUV without paying premium brand premiums, provided they are comfortable with a relatively new marque in India. Its resale value is gradually improving as the brand gains recognition.
vs Competitors
Against rivals like the Tata Safari, Hyundai Creta and Kia Seltos, the Hector Plus offers a larger third‑row and a more premium infotainment experience, while pricing remains lower than the Safari. Its safety package surpasses the Creta’s standard offering, and the 7‑seat flexibility gives it an edge over the Seltos. However, the Safari still leads in diesel refinement and off‑road capability, and the Creta boasts a stronger resale track record. Overall, the Hector Plus balances space, tech, and price better than most competitors, though it trails the most established brands in long‑term reliability and resale value.

The Smart Pro MT hits the sweet spot by including essential active safety systems like ESC, Traction Control, and Hill Assist, which are non-negotiable for a vehicle of this size. At Rs 17.99 Lakh, it avoids the premium pricing of the top-end while retaining the core appeal of the Hector Plus platform. Buyers get the full-size spare tyre and ISOFIX mounts, ensuring child safety is not compromised. Compared to the base variant, this trim adds necessary creature comforts like advanced infotainment connectivity that justify the marginal price jump. It is the most logical choice for families who want the safety of 6 airbags and the reliability of a manual gearbox without paying for vanity features like high-end ambient lighting or advanced voice command suites. The resale value of the Smart Pro trim is historically stronger than the entry-level variant because it satisfies the 'feature-loaded' requirement of the secondary market. It competes directly with the mid-spec variants of the Tata Safari, offering more standard safety tech at a lower price point.

The Hector Plus typically retains approximately 60-65% of its value after 3 years in the Indian market. Its high feature-to-price ratio keeps demand steady against competitors like the Tata Safari and Mahindra XUV700.
With a wide footprint, the Hector Plus demands careful maneuvering in tight city traffic, though the high seating position provides excellent road visibility. The ground clearance is adequate for Indian speed breakers, but the length requires planning for narrow parking slots.
The petrol engine provides sufficient torque for cruising, though the manual transmission requires frequent gear shifts during overtakes compared to the diesel alternatives. NVH levels are well-controlled, maintaining cabin serenity even at speeds of 100-120 kmph.
